Noodleman at Riverwalk; Hot Rods to show mascot; Bulls trumpet concert

The Bowling Green Hot Rods just announced that they'll introduce their mascot before tonight's game against West Virginia. (The San Francisco Crab, lower right, formerly of the Giants, has been out of work for a while.)

Earlier today, the Durham Bulls announced they'll have Bob Dylan, Willie Nelson and John Mellencamp for a concert July 28. Tickets cost $67.75 and go on sale May 9. The tour isn't coming to Montgomery, but it will hit the Southern League. The Tennessee Smokies host a concert July 29, the day after Durham.

That's more exciting than what's happened to the Biscuits this week. Montgomery, strummer of 13 hits in its last three games, ends a home series with the Mobile BayBears.

Myron Noodleman (upper right) will be in the house. Lineups ...
